鹿鸣酥 (@lgnorant-lu) 在 望佬们对 Repo 的推进形态/内容作指教 中发帖
始:
折腾了个 NeteaseHookSDK ,起因是友人自开发的 Win 工具包 JC[Jackal Client] 中的之一 Tools:
「更好的歌词」:(臆断取名)同步显示本地网易云的实时播放进度(与对应歌词),以进行更精细化个性化的开发。
起初刷到友人[WormWaker]该工具包视频(小破站)时,还是采用的小 OCR (后好像其优化为 Hook 了) 获取对应歌词 *.lyc),但是核心痛点依在:同步的鲁棒性。Electron 的动态特性让传统内存扫描波动易碎。
于是 repo:[NeteaseHookSDK] 产生了进一步折腾(同步处理)。
一次大概是有效折腾学习的记录:
先抬结论:
这是一个利用 DLL 劫持 + CDP 桥接 + 事件注入监听 实现的同本地 NCM 播放进度同步的 SDK,以便于用于个性化精细化开发。
研
调试分析得到了页面返回实时进度…
详情链接:
https://linux.do/t/topic/1346137/1
来源: LINUX DO, 消息ID: 264096
爱站程序员基地

